Since Sept. 2020, the Chinese government has attempted to forcibly change
the primary education language in Mongolian schools in Inner Mongolia from
Mongolian to Mandarin. When students and parents took action
against this policy to keep their mother tongue, they were blocked by local
police and authorities. Many Mongolians were unable to withstand the
pressure and were forced to commit suicide.
1. Violation of Human Rights
We are born equal and independent. The lack of mother tongue in the
education will lead to extinction.
2. World Heritage Violation
The Mongolian script was registered by UNESCO in 2013. The new policy
grossly violates this agreement.
3. Violation of Its Own Constitution
It also violates the Constitution of the Autonomous Region and the
Constitution of the P.R.C.
